diff options
-rw-r--r-- | .SRCINFO | 38 | ||||
-rw-r--r-- | .gitignore | 3 | ||||
-rw-r--r-- | PKGBUILD | 55 |
3 files changed, 96 insertions, 0 deletions
diff --git a/.SRCINFO b/.SRCINFO new file mode 100644 index 000000000000..e164cf67e8d8 --- /dev/null +++ b/.SRCINFO @@ -0,0 +1,38 @@ +pkgbase = python-heatclient + pkgdesc = Python client library for Heat + pkgver = 0.8.0 + pkgrel = 1 + url = https://launchpad.net/python-heatclient + arch = any + license = Apache + source = https://pypi.python.org/packages/source/p/python-heatclient/python-heatclient-0.8.0.tar.gz + sha256sums = 5cd1c855ee21f18bfffbc7269e40c417b953d0855aa3cc8b56d778b8612467d5 + +pkgname = python-heatclient + depends = python-babel>=1.3 + depends = python-pbr>=0.6 + depends = python-iso8601>=0.1.9 + depends = python-prettytable>=0.7 + depends = python-oslo-i18n + depends = python-oslo-serialization + depends = python-oslo-utils + depends = python-swiftclient + depends = python-keystoneclient + depends = python-yaml + depends = python-requests>=2.2.0 + depends = python-six>=1.7.0 + +pkgname = python2-heatclient + depends = python2-babel>=1.3 + depends = python2-pbr>=0.6 + depends = python2-iso8601>=0.1.9 + depends = python2-prettytable>=0.7 + depends = python2-oslo-i18n + depends = python2-oslo-serialization + depends = python2-oslo-utils + depends = python2-swiftclient + depends = python2-keystoneclient + depends = python2-yaml + depends = python2-requests>=2.2.0 + depends = python2-six>=1.7.0 + diff --git a/.gitignore b/.gitignore new file mode 100644 index 000000000000..3317ac6609e8 --- /dev/null +++ b/.gitignore @@ -0,0 +1,3 @@ +/pkg/ +/src/ +/*.tar.* diff --git a/PKGBUILD b/PKGBUILD new file mode 100644 index 000000000000..e38a23eae793 --- /dev/null +++ b/PKGBUILD @@ -0,0 +1,55 @@ +# Maintainer: Christoph Gysin <christoph.gysin@gmail.com> + +pkgname=('python-heatclient' 'python2-heatclient') +pkgver='0.8.0' +pkgrel='1' +pkgdesc='Python client library for Heat' +arch=('any') +url='https://launchpad.net/python-heatclient' +license=('Apache') +source=("https://pypi.python.org/packages/source/${pkgname:0:1}/${pkgname}/${pkgname}-${pkgver}.tar.gz") +sha256sums=('5cd1c855ee21f18bfffbc7269e40c417b953d0855aa3cc8b56d778b8612467d5') + +package_python-heatclient() +{ + depends=('python-babel>=1.3' + 'python-pbr>=0.6' + 'python-iso8601>=0.1.9' + 'python-prettytable>=0.7' + 'python-oslo-i18n' + 'python-oslo-serialization' + 'python-oslo-utils' + 'python-swiftclient' + 'python-keystoneclient' + 'python-yaml' + 'python-requests>=2.2.0' + 'python-six>=1.7.0') + makedepends=('python-setuptools') + cd "${srcdir}/${pkgname}-${pkgver}" + python setup.py \ + install \ + --root="${pkgdir}" \ + --optimize=1 +} + +package_python2-heatclient() +{ + depends=('python2-babel>=1.3' + 'python2-pbr>=0.6' + 'python2-iso8601>=0.1.9' + 'python2-prettytable>=0.7' + 'python2-oslo-i18n' + 'python2-oslo-serialization' + 'python2-oslo-utils' + 'python2-swiftclient' + 'python2-keystoneclient' + 'python2-yaml' + 'python2-requests>=2.2.0' + 'python2-six>=1.7.0') + makedepends=('python2-setuptools') + cd "${srcdir}/python-heatclient-${pkgver}" + python2 setup.py \ + install \ + --root="${pkgdir}" \ + --optimize=1 +} |